Перейти к содержанию
Форум поддержки пользователей VamShop

Изменение главной картинки товара при выборе цвета (ат


Рекомендуемые сообщения

Добрый день!

Требуется, чтобы при выборе атрибута-цвета товара главная картинка товара тоже менялась на товар нужного цвета.

Также нужно убрать радио-буттон по выбору атрибута, выбор должен происходить по клику на картинку атрибута.

Учесть, что не все товары имеют атрибуты.

С уважением,

Павел.

Ссылка на сообщение
Поделиться на другие сайты
  • 2 weeks later...

Добрый день!

Вот алгоритм:

алгоритм:

1. При добавлении картинки к атрибуту создавать две дополнительных картинки:

а. размера (Ширина картинки на странице карточки товара x Высота картинки на странице карточки товара) в специальной папке /images/attribute_images/info_images/

б. размера (Ширина картинки в pop-up окне x Высота картинки в pop-up окне) в специальной папке /images/attribute_images/popup_images/

2. При загрузке карточки товара (product_info_v1.html)

Проверять, если у товара есть арибуты, то

    $PRODUCTS_IMAGE = путь к картинке первого атрибута из папки info_images

    $PRODUCTS_POPUP_IMAGE = путь к картинке первого атрибута из папки popup_images

3. При клике на картинку-атрибут установить радио-буттон атрибута

4. При изменении радио-буттона атрибута

    $PRODUCTS_IMAGE = путь к картинке кликнутого атрибута из папки info_images

    $PRODUCTS_POPUP_IMAGE = путь к картинке кликнутого атрибута из папки popup_images

и перегрузить $PRODUCTS_IMAGE

Может кто-нибудь реализовать?

Ссылка на сообщение
Поделиться на другие сайты

Помоему еще нужно учесть, если будет добавляться другой тип атрибутов. Тоесть не для выбора цвета.

Ссылка на сообщение
Поделиться на другие сайты

Я не знаю, как один вид атрибута отделить от другого - сможете подсказать?

Хотя, для меня это не критично, т.е. возможно реализовать и так.

Ссылка на сообщение
Поделиться на другие сайты

Я бы добавил еще один тип аттрибута "Выбор цвета". И в админке при добавлении проверял, если это именно этот атрибут, тогда создавать две картинки. Если нет, делать все как обычно.

ИМХО нужно стараться оставить стандартный функционал, а то потом понадобиться, и нужно будет думать как выкручиваться.

Ссылка на сообщение
Поделиться на другие сайты

Согласен, теперь бы найти исполнителя... Удивительно, но ни одного предложения! Никому деньги не нужны чтоль...

Ссылка на сообщение
Поделиться на другие сайты

Согласен, теперь бы найти исполнителя... Удивительно, но ни одного предложения! Никому деньги не нужны чтоль...

Могу сделать, но если только завтра.

Ссылка на сообщение
Поделиться на другие сайты
  • 1 month later...
  • 3 weeks later...

Удалось кому-нибудь реализовать?

Могу взяться за реализацию.

Для смены картинок будет использоваться jScript

Ссылка на сообщение
Поделиться на другие сайты
  • 1 month later...
×
×
  • Создать...